Elite Eye Care in Arden, N.C., led by Dr. Haley Perry, has integrated artificial intelligence (AI) to streamline operations and enhance efficiency across various roles. The practice leverages AI tools such as ChatGPT for assisting non-English speaking patients, managing inventory, handling claim denials, and transcribing patient notes. The marketing team uses AI to identify trends and create targeted campaigns, significantly boosting revenue. Dr. Perry has observed substantial productivity gains, allowing the team to focus on higher-value activities. Despite initial hesitation, staff have embraced AI after recognizing its potential. They utilize AI tools like Scribe for creating office protocols, Recast for converting articles into podcasts, and various apps for making marketing videos. Moving forward, the practice plans to use AI for goal-setting, data analysis, and problem anticipation, hoping for further integration with electronic medical records to automate documentation and improve patient care.
